What Are Online Psychiatry Services?
Psychiatrist Online UK services supply consultations, medical diagnoses, and even treatment plans, such as medication prescriptions and therapy, through digital platforms. These services connect clients with certified psychiatrists by means of video calls, chat platforms, or other digital tools.
For people who might find it challenging to attend in-person visits due to geographical, physical, or time restraints, online psychiatry services have proven to be a game-changer. Whether you remain in a dynamic city or a remote town, as long as you have a web connection, help can now be just a click away.
Key Benefits of Online Psychiatry Services
Convenience and Accessibility
One of the most considerable benefits of online psychiatry is ease of access. With versatile appointment scheduling, clients can book consultations sometimes that fit their busy way of lives. This is especially important for people who work full-time, have caregiving duties, or face movement difficulties.
Much Shorter Waiting Times
The UK's NHS psychological health services are often overloaded, causing comprehensive waiting durations. Online psychiatry platforms can decrease these delays, offering quicker access to expert care and ensuring prompt intervention, which is crucial for psychological health recovery.
Anonimity and Privacy
Some individuals hesitate to participate in in person treatment or psychiatry sessions due to the preconception surrounding psychological health. Online services offer a degree of privacy and discretion, allowing clients to look for help without the worry of judgment.
Vast Array of Services
Online psychiatrists in the UK can provide holistic care, including treatment, medication management, and follow-up consultations. Some platforms even use 24/7 crisis assistance, making sure that aid is offered for emergencies.
Cost-Effectiveness
While private mental healthcare can be costly, online psychiatry services typically use more budget-friendly alternatives compared to in-person consultations. Additionally, patients save money on travel expenses, making it a budget-friendly alternative.

Limitations and Challenges
While online psychiatry offers various benefits, it is not without its difficulties. Particular psychological health conditions, especially extreme cases, may require in-person care or inpatient treatment, which online consultations can not offer. In addition, some patients may feel that the virtual format lacks the personal connection of in person interactions.
Moreover, availability can be a barrier for people without dependable internet access or technological proficiency, although actions are being taken to address this digital divide.

How to Choose the Right Online Psychiatrist in the UK
If you're thinking about online psychiatry, it's necessary to choose a reliable and dependable service provider. Look for platforms or specialists who are regist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) or other relevant regulatory bodies. Check out reviews, inquire about costs, and inspect whether they offer services covered by insurance or health insurance.
Furthermore, make sure the platform complies with data defense laws, like GDPR, to safeguard your individual details throughout assessments.
